Malcolm Hamilton, a Principal with Mercer Human Resource Consulting Limited, with Rob Carrick from the Globe and Mail discuss how much you need to save for retirement.
* What percentage of your working income do you need to have when you retire?
* How does spending in your retirement compare to your working years?
* What kind of retirement life will you have if you have 50% of your income each year?
* Is it necessary to maximize RRSP contributions each year?
* At what age should you be maximizing your RRSP savings?
